> I have a PC, and have recently acquired an Apple //e. The Apple came
> with no software at all, and has no hard drive. I can get image files
> for ProDOS, DOS 3.3, etc. from ftp sites, and I used these with
> emulators before I got the //e. Now though, I want to move this software
> over to the real machine. How do I get the PC to write a disk image onto
> a disk? I've tried using rawrite (like you use for a Linux LILO disk)
> but the //e wouldn't read it. Can this be done?
....
If your //e has an Super Serial Card, you can use ADT to do the transfers.
For details, see http://home.swbell.net/rubywand/Csa2T1TCOM.html#003 .
